Question 86 560sl air cond problem

I have a 86 560SL and have a few probs to troubleshoot. 1. AC only blows cold air at the full cold temp setting. Any other setting on the temp wheel and the temp goes full hot!! 2. Cruise does not work... is there a fuse to check? I looked in the panel and there is not a fuse marked Cruise,,,is it somewhere else?

I would suspect bad solder joints in the AC controller. They fail due to age and vibration. They can be repaired if you know how to solder on electronic printed circuit boards. I have seen the solder joints on the temp setting control to fail more often than others.
